## Service Accounts: Webhook Delivery

The `hookrunner-svc` account owns all outbound webhook delivery for Driftline. Retry semantics: exponential backoff, base 2s, cap 10m, max 12 attempts, then dead-letter. Retries are idempotent per delivery ID; receivers must dedupe on it. Reviewers: reject any change that retries on 4xx other than 429. The account authenticates to the internal delivery gateway with a scoped key, rotated monthly. Current key follows.

app token of yajeg-kawef = kto11_7En3XSX8xQw

## Lunewick Environments — User Module Split

The user module was extracted from the Lunewick monolith into its own service, `usercore`. Prod traffic is split 80/20 via the gateway; staging is 100% on the new service. Rollback is a gateway flag flip, no deploy needed. The service boots with the following configuration values.

config for kafof-bawef:
holath:
  log_level: debug
  metrics_host: metrics.holath.qorvelsys.internal
  pin: 2191
  pool_size: 32

The Orvane Labs bike cage and the east and west parking gates operate on separate access schedules, and facilities desk staff should note that visitor vehicles may only use the west gate between 07:00 and 19:00. Cyclists requesting cage access must show a valid day pass, and their details should be entered in the access ledger before the cage is opened. Gates must never be propped open, even briefly, during deliveries. When a manual override is required at either gate, use the code below.

staff pass of fadup-fawig = bdg-FUNKS-4

## Vendor Note: Nightly Reindex (Querystone)

The nightly search reindex is run by our vendor Querystone under the Meadowbrook contract. Reviewers should know that index schema changes require a vendor ticket and a 48-hour lead time; merging schema PRs without one will cause the nightly job to fail silently. Check the vendor SLA dashboard before approving. For schema coordination, contact the Querystone integration desk.

escalation mailbox, bafog-fafog: ulador@paliqlabs.internal